Output 675e8bcdef9ea4a343366184de5aa5452f528a1cd816f5a9c394a1d47f40acae:19

value
2060000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0611353e69b100e1965852aad7e644edda0ae5fb OP_EQUAL
address
32F6bKtFgyYCw4c7JiGz7s6cny1VJQavCy
transaction
675e8bcdef9ea4a343366184de5aa5452f528a1cd816f5a9c394a1d47f40acae
confirmations
503464
spent
true